I previously modified the central control screen and added some new features, but to be honest, it brought quite a few safety risks. If installed improperly, loose wiring connections can easily cause short circuits, sparking, or even fires, especially in hot weather, which is even more dangerous. What's worse, modern car central controls are tied to critical systems like airbags and anti-lock brakes, and modifications may cause malfunctions, leading to protection failures during accidents. My neighbor experienced this issue—his airbags didn’t deploy in a crash. consumption also increased, making it hard to start the car after parking overnight. The factory warranty was voided outright, and the dealership refused to cover repairs, forcing me to pay out of pocket for replacement parts. If you really want to modify it, choose a professional and reputable shop—don’t try to save money by doing it yourself—and ensure wiring and firmware are thoroughly tested.

As a seasoned driver with over a decade of experience, I emphasize that modifying the infotainment system primarily impacts and warranty. Once altered, the factory warranty is virtually voided—manufacturers won't cover circuit issues, leaving you to foot repair bills. Repairs become more complex, as conflicts between old and new systems require professional diagnostics, consuming time and money. It may also affect insurance claims; if an accident is linked to modifications, compensation could be reduced. My advice: avoid tampering with the infotainment system during the first few years of a new car, or opt for factory-upgraded components. Even routine repairs and part replacements become cumbersome, necessitating shops familiar with modifications to prevent unnecessary disputes and costs.

From a technical perspective, the impact of modifying the center console primarily lies in compatibility issues. Electrical system malfunctions may occur, as the original vehicle's voltage design has limitations—excessive power draw from new devices can easily blow fuses or damage ECU modules. Functional conflicts are common, such as erratic air conditioning temperature control or disabled advanced driver-assistance systems, requiring additional adapters due to logic mismatches. Improper installation can also cause electromagnetic interference, resulting in significant radio static. It is recommended to use components compatible with the original vehicle's protocol, regularly check for firmware updates, and ensure proper grounding and shielding stability during installation to minimize failure rates.
